Chuck Fausel is retiring, and his impressive stable of vintage racers is up for sale, either individually or as a collection. The newest car is a NASCAR veteran from the 1990s, and the oldest is a 1920 Model T fitted with a Rajo overhead valve conversion. The provenance and history of the cars is fascinating and genuine, unlike some of the other schlock you see on eBay. The Camaro GS Race Car Concept takes its inspiration from the Trans Am racer of Mark Donohue, but Riley Technologies updates it with a just a few go-fast add-ons. The body is seam-welded, the hood, trunk lid, and doors are swapped for carbon fiber components, and in the front a racing radiator and an upgraded engine cooler are fitted. The production LS3 V8 swaps gears though a Tremec close-ration six-speed gearbox, and all those spent hydrocarbons exit through three-inch dual exhaust pipes. Even better than all that: you can buy it from Riley for the 2009 Grand Am season. The latest offering is the <a href="http://www.ginettacars.com/G50/News/240506-Launch.htm">G50</a>, a wide, low-slung, lightweight coupe the company plans to build a cup race around. With only 800kg (1,750 pounds) to push around, the mid-mounted, 300hp, 3.5 liter Ford V6 should make this one sexy-fast ride.<br /><br /><a href="http://carscoop.blogspot.com/2007/05/ginetta-g50-all-new-300hp-sports-car.html"><img vspace="4" hspace="4" border="0" align="right" alt="" src="http://www.blogcdn.com/www.autoblog.com/media/2007/05/ginetta_logo_200.jpg" /></a>In 2005, Ginetta was bought by LNT Automotive, run by veteran racer <a href="http://www.teamlnt.com/LawrTom.htm">Lawrence Tomlinson.</a> He says the first 30 real versions of the virtual renderings you see <a href="http://www.autoblog.com/photos/ginetta-g50/">here</a> are already in production and should be ready for sale in early 2008.<br /><br />Tomlinson said the first 30 G50s are a good mix of  "<span class="fullpost"><span style="font-family: Tahoma;">cup, road and GT4 cars</span></span>." The company's press release (read it in full after the jump) promises the cup series will be set up to keep costs down with 10 race weekends, a "substantial prize fund" and guaranteed TV coverage. "We've designed the G50 as a stepping stone for GT drivers," Tomlinson said.<br /><br />Projected cost for the G50 is around &pound;35,000. But don't get too excited.
